Blending dance with Sufi music

Mansiya presented a unique synthesis of art forms

The 82nd anniversary celebrations of the Temple Entry Proclamation marked presentation of an innovative dance programme by

V.P. Mansiya blending Sufi music with the classical steps of Bharatnatyam.

The Moyinkutty Vaidyar Mapila Kala Academy auditorium at Kondotty witnessed the unique synthesis of art forms on the third day of the celebrations on Monday.

Mansiya staged the Bharatnatyam in Sufi style culling 11 minutes of a 90-minute programme she prepared during her M.Phil pursuit.

She said she had been inspired to do the innovation from a Delhi dancer.

Besides, Mansiya staged the traditional dance items extolling Chidambeswaran at the event.
